How Our Solar Wind Hybrid Street Light System Works
1. Solar & Wind Harvesting
High-efficiency solar panels and wind turbines collect energy continuously.
2. Battery Storage
Energy is stored in durable LiFePO4 batteries.
3. Intelligent Switching
Grid/Wind Backup activates when battery drops <20%.
4. High-Lumen LED Output
Consistent, bright illumination exactly when needed.

Hybrid Solar Street Light FAQ
How does hybrid solar light switch to AC? expand_more
Our intelligent MPPT controller continuously monitors battery voltage. When capacity drops below a pre-set threshold (usually 20%), the system automatically seamlessly switches to AC grid power or wind backup without interrupting the lighting output.
What is the lifespan of the battery? expand_more
We utilize automotive-grade LiFePO4 batteries designed for over 4,000 deep charge cycles, typically translating to a reliable lifespan of 8 to 10 years depending on environmental conditions.
Can it withstand extreme cold? expand_more
Yes, our systems are engineered to operate in temperatures ranging from -20°C to 60°C. For extreme cold regions, we offer models with built-in battery heating elements to maintain optimal charging efficiency.
